检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:王斌锐[1] 徐崟[1] 金英连[1] 吴善强[1]
机构地区:[1]中国计量学院机电工程学院,浙江杭州310018
出 处:《兵工学报》2012年第11期1329-1334,共6页Acta Armamentarii
基 金:国家自然科学基金项目(50905170);浙江省自然科学基金项目(Y1090042)
摘 要:转动抖动补偿是视频稳像的难点,针对转动抖动补偿中的关键技术特征点的筛选与匹配展开研究。建立了图像的6参数仿射模型;推导得到估计有意运动参数的超定方程;采用最小二乘迭代算法来去除绝对误差和(SAD)算法误判的特征点;采用金字塔(LK)光流算法来对旋转视频进行特征点匹配。编程实现算法;用特征窗口梯度矩阵法(KLT)提取特征后,分别用SAD算法和LK光流算法进行匹配,求解得到旋转变换阵参数误差,分析、比较并图示了误差原因;利用Kalman滤波去除无意运动;对含转动抖动的视频进行稳像补偿。在自主移动机器人平台上开展了实验。结果表明LK光流算法相比SAD算法对旋转视频的特征点匹配误差小,结合Kalman滤波可有效补偿转动抖动,将最大8.37°的转动抖动稳像到3.68°以下。Rotary jitter compensation is a difficulty in video image stabilization. The feature point matc- hing and inaccurate point filtering were studied. An affine model with 6 parameters was established for moving images, and an over-determined equation to estimate motion parameters was derived. The least squares iterative algorithm was used to remove error feature points judged by sum of absolute difference (SAD) matching algorithm. A pyramid-style Lucas-Kanade (LK) algorithm based on optical flow was a- dopted for feature point matching of rotary video. All algorithms were programmed. After detecting feature points by using the gradient matrix of the feature window (KLT) method, SAD and LK algorithms were used to match feature points respectively, and the rotation matrix parameter errors were obtained and compared. The reasons of matching error were analyzed. Kalman filter was used to smooth rotation param- eters. All algorithms were implemented on an autonomous robot. The experiment results show that LK can get less matching errors than SAD for rotation jitter, and Kalman filter makes the maximum 8.37~ rotation jitter less than 3.68~, thus it can compensate the rotary video effectively.
分 类 号:TP242[自动化与计算机技术—检测技术与自动化装置]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.7